图书馆信息管理系统的设计和开发研究
作者:张岩
来源:《科技信息·下旬刊》2017年第07期
摘要:在当前信息化时代,人们信息交流的方式发生了较大的变化。图书馆作为知识和信息传播的重要场所,其工作质量与人们素质的提高息息相关。随着图书馆读者和藏书量的不断增加,为了更好的满足读者的需求,需要通过合理分配资源来为读者提供高效快捷的信息搜索服务,因此需要通过设计和开发出合理的图书信息管理系统,以此来实现对图书资源的科学化和网络化管理。
关键词:图书馆;信息管理系统;设计;功能模板
在网络技术的推广应用过程中,图书馆加快了信息化管理建设的进程。图书馆信息管理系统不仅信息较为丰富,并且与科研和技术部门有效链接,为信息的处理、集中提供了良好的平台,实现对图书编目、检索、借还、查阅和典藏等的集中化管理。可以说图书馆信息管理系统发挥着非常重要的作用,因此对其进行设计开发已成为大势所趋。 一、图书馆信息管理系统的需求
图书馆信息管理系统在设计和开发过程中需要满足来自于图书借阅者和图书馆管理人员两方面的需求。对于借阅功能需求,由于图书借阅者需要查询图书馆图书情况、查询本人借书情况和个人信息等,这些问题通过本人借书证号和密码登记图书馆信息管理系统即可实现。通常情况下,图书借阅者只能够对本人的借书情况和个人信息进行查询。因此图书馆信息管理系统在满足借阅者的借阅需求的同时,还需要对图书借阅者的个人隐私进行保护。因此在具体开发设计过程中,需要设置功能模块,具体包括图书信息检索、图书借阅管理和个人资料管理、图书借阅查询统计及预借续借管理等。作为图书管理人员,在实际工作中需要对图书借阅者办证、退证、借书、还书、续借查询等进行操作,因此在具体设计开发过程中要考虑到图书馆管理人员登陆本模块的便利性,即需要在本模块中增加录入新证、退证、借书记录、还书记录,续借记录等并能够将其打印成相应的报表,为用户提供查看和确认。在图书管理功能需求方面,由于信息量较大,对于数据安全性和保密性具有较高的要求,同时图书馆管理人员还能够对基本信息和借阅信息进行浏览、查询、添加、删除、修改等,因此管理功能模块设计时,需要将读者信息管理、图书基本信息管理、借书信息管理、还书信息管理、数据统计和各种报表生成等内容都要囊括在内。 二、图书馆信息管理系统设计 (一)系统功能构架设计
龙源期刊网 http://www.qikan.com.cn
图书管理系统主要的功能由图书流通管理,读者管理,读者预约,预借管理,系统设置,借阅查询统计,财经查询统计,日志查询系统、流通维护等组成。不同的图书管理员用户组应该具有不同的作用,根据其不同的权限可以访问不同的版块。 (二)系统开发架构
图书信息管理系统中的三层架构主要是利用了简单工厂设计模式抽象出来的模块接口,摆脱了对具体数据库的依赖,有利于数据库的扩充和迁移,实现了多数据库支持。Model层包括所有实体类,主要映射数据库的视图或数据表。实体层贯穿于业务逻辑层,表示层和数据访问层,在这三层之间进行信息传递和调用。 (三)系统安全设计
由于该系统直接与互联网连接,这样就必然存在数据信息安全和整个系统安全受到威胁的情况,因此在设计时要对系统的网络安全问题给予高度重视。在图书信息管理系统安全设计方面,通常会采用B/S架构,并在实际防护中采用防火墙技术、用户身份验证和设置访问权限等,以此来加强图书馆信息管理系统的安全性。另外,还可以通过登陆追加验证码、数据加密及权限管理等方法,有效的避免内网受到非法用户侵入,保护系统的安全。 三、图书馆信息管理系统功能模板设计 (一)登录模板
登录模板是系统安全的基本保障,其设计需要进行权限的等级管理。登录系统时,根据预先设定的权限,规定系统管理员与图书管理员不同等级,进入系统之后便可进行权限相关的操作。当用户进入图书信息管理系统后,需要通过登录模板输入账号和密码,以验证用户身份。用户身份有效性的确认是判断其是否具有进入系统的正确信息,用户类型的验证则是通过用户类型的确认来决定用户在系统中的操作权限。 (二)基本信息管理模板
图书馆信息管理系统中的基本信息主要以读者信息、图书分类信息和出版信息为主,在该模板中,图书管理人员和系统管理员可以对基本信息进行添加、删除和修改等。读者信息管理模式中读者信息主要包括读者姓名、编码和类型等,利用该模板能够对读者信息进行具体的管理操作。在管理图书类别时需要利用到图书分类信息模板,通常情况下图书类别可以分为一级和二级,一级类别在系统界面上进行显示,当点击一级图书名称时,下属的二级类别也会显示出来。管理员能够直接对一级类别图书信息进行修改,二级类别信息需要单独选中后才能进行具体的修改。对于出版管理模板,其主要是对图书出版相关的信息进行管理,用户在查阅时可以选择出版信息中的一条信息,界面右侧会将选中的信息显示出来,从而查阅到自己所需要的信息。
龙源期刊网 http://www.qikan.com.cn
(三)图书信息管理模板
图书信息管理模板涉及图书的入馆、借阅和归还三项内容管理。首先,入馆管理的功能是当图书入馆时记录到系统中,并确认入馆时间,之后将入馆图书详细录入到该模板中。其次,借阅管理的功能是管理借阅书籍的信息,一旦读者借阅书籍,图书管理员就需要通过扫描书籍信息以录入借阅管理模板中,系统运行过程中,管理员就可以查看所有借阅书籍信息。最后,归还管理的功能是管理书籍归还的信息。如果读者归还图书,与借阅管理模板一样需要将归还图书信息录入该模板中,以便系统管理员进行归还图书的操作。 (四)系统管理模板
系统管理模板属于特定权限用户才可进行操作的管理模板,图书管理信息系统中系统管理员和图书管理员可进入该模板进行相关操作,管理项目包括用户管理与密码管理。系统运行过程中,系统会以列表的形式显示用户,如果管理员需要管理某个用户,直接点击该用户,系统就会将用户的名称和类别显示在界面中。修改密码的功能主要有两个,首先通过该模板管理员可以添加、删除或者修改用户,还有一般用户需要更改登录密码时,只需要进入系统选择“修改密码”,自行更换密码,而不需要向管理员申请。 四、结束语
图书馆信息管理系统功能十分强大,基本实现了书籍出版的自动或是半自动化管理,有效的规避了人工管理的弊端。在图书馆中通过应用信息管理系统,不仅为图书管理带来了更多的便利,而且大量图书及用户数据的存储、管理和更新成为可能,在具体运行过程中,图书馆信息管理系统具有较好的安全性和可靠性,呈现也较强的人性化特点,为用户操作提供了更多的便利,而且能够与其他系统进行配合使用,实现图书的自动归类、自动检索和自动出库,检索更为快速、查找便利,提高了图书馆管理的效率,为图书馆管理的科学化和正规化起到了重要的保障。 参考文献:
[1]许泉城.基于Web的图书馆管理信息系统的分析[J].数字化用户,2014(6). [2]曾晖.高校图书馆信息管理系统的设计电脑知识与技术 2012(8).
[3]杨宗模.图书馆信息管理系统需求分析[J].计算机光盘软件与应用,2011(10).
因篇幅问题不能全部显示,请点此查看更多更全内容